Webb17 jan. 2024 · For example, a person may disclaim 1,000 out of a total 2,000 shares of stock in an estate, but he or she cannot accept the dividends for life and disclaim the “remainder interest” in those shares after his or her death. In that case, a “vertical” disclaimer of half the shares will work, but a “horizontal” disclaimer would not work. WebbPython Inheritance. WebbExample 3. Alan is entitled to a one-third share in the residuary estate. He receives £500 on account. If he accepts this sum he cannot then disclaim his share in the … WebbFor example, consider an unmarried father who dies intestate — without a will or trust – and is survived by a son and a daughter — his heirs. Prior to settling dad’s estate, the son decides to give his one-half share to his sister and signs and notarizes an assignment of inheritance rights. The assignment is then filed with the Court. toy chica audio https://roschi.net

WebbQuick Summary: Arizona Disclaimer Deed. In Arizona, property acquired during the marriage is typically community property. Upon divorce, the courts will equally divide community property. However, when a spouse signs an Arizona disclaimer deed when purchasing a house, the signing spouse no longer owns an interest in the house.
